Laws That Shield Buyers

The Federal Trade payment (FTC) possess a number of legislation and arrangements to guard customers financing, and it stocks down enforcement nicely.

  • Reality in financing operate of 1968 makes it necessary that the stipulations of all financing be spelled completely clearly through the loan processes.
  • The financing procedures Trade rules Rule, administered of the FTC, is designed to shield consumers by forbidding specific credit practices.
  • The digital resources exchange Act covers the use of ATMs, debit cards, direct bank exchanges, and the like, and grants the consumer specific protections, including the data recovery of unauthorized or unlawful transfers.
  • The State of Kansas also has a law governing temporary (at the most thirty day period) financial loans of $500 or decreased, capping rates of interest at 15percent.
